      On June 5, 1662, the town of Guilford (Conn.) voted to send George Hubbard as a messenger to invite Rev. Joseph Eliot to become pastor in the town. If he decline Hubbard is directed to ask the opinion of Messrs. Gookin, Mitchell and Mather with reference to calling 'one Mr. Stoughton, who (as we hear) is coming out of England.' Mr. Eliot, however, accepted the call.

      At least two different George Hubbards lived in Connecticut at the same time: this one - George (c 1594-1683), husband of Mary, and resident of Watertown, Massachusetts, Wethersfield, Milford and Guilford, Connecticut. and - George (1601-1685), husband of Elizabeth Watts and resident of Hartford and Middletown, Connecticut.
